Lets compare vitamin content per 300 calories of Fresh Orange juice vs Snacks, corn-based, extruded, onion-flavor:
300 calories of Fresh Orange juice have 13.9 times more Vitamin A, 4.5 times more Vitamin B1, 1.4 times more Vitamin B3, 8 times more Vitamin B5, 3 times more Vitamin B6, 3 times more Vitamin B9 and 308 times more Vitamin C than Snacks, corn-based, extruded, onion-flavor.
While 300 kcal of Snacks, corn-based, extruded, onion-flavor contain 6.1 times more Vitamin E than Raw Orange juice.
Both Fresh Orange juice and Snacks, corn-based, extruded, onion-flavor provide similar amounts of Vitamin B2 per 300 calories.
300 calories of Fresh Orange juice have insufficient amounts of Vitamin E
300 calories of Snacks, corn-based, extruded, onion-flavor have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A, Vitamin B5 and Vitamin C
Both Raw Orange juice as well as Snacks, corn-based, extruded, onion-flavor have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12, Vitamin D and Vitamin K in 300 calories.
Comparing minerals per 300 calories for Fresh Orange juice vs Snacks, corn-based, extruded, onion-flavor:
300 calories of Fresh Orange juice have 4.2 times more Calcium, 4.1 times more Copper, 4.4 times more Magnesium, 2.6 times more Phosphorus, 15.5 times more Potassium and 489.6 times more Water than Snacks, corn-based, extruded, onion-flavor.
While 300 kcal of Snacks, corn-based, extruded, onion-flavor contain 1.7 times more Iron, 9.6 times more Selenium and 85.7 times more Sodium than Raw Orange juice.
300 calories of Fresh Orange juice lack sufficient amounts of Selenium
300 calories of Snacks, corn-based, extruded, onion-flavor lack sufficient amounts of Calcium, Magnesium and Potassium
Both Raw Orange juice as well as Snacks, corn-based, extruded, onion-flavor lack sufficient amounts of Manganese and Zinc in 300 calories.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 300 calories:
300 calories of Fresh Orange juice have 1.8 times more Carbohydrate and 19.3 times more Sugars than Snacks, corn-based, extruded, onion-flavor.
While 300 kcal of Snacks, corn-based, extruded, onion-flavor contain 10.2 times more Fat, 16.3 times more Saturated Fat, 9.4 times more Omega 6 and 1.8 times more Fiber than Raw Orange juice.
Both Fresh Orange juice and Snacks, corn-based, extruded, onion-flavor offer comparable quantities of Energy and Protein per 300 calories.
300 calories of Fresh Orange juice provide inadequate amounts of Omega 6 and Fiber
Both Raw Orange juice as well as Snacks, corn-based, extruded, onion-flavor provide inadequate amounts of Omega 3 in 300 calories.
